^The Mark 21 pedestal mount was in the limit of turning masses which could be simply manhandled. to receive to this fat, BuOrd sacrificed shields and ammunition hoists and accepted the resulting reduce level of fireplace. Ammunition for these pedestal mounts was fed from deck mounted scuttles, from which rounds may very well be passed to your Mechanical Fuze Setter Found about the rotating mount. As finished, destroyers with Mark 21 bow mounts experienced easy open up-back again shields even though the stern mounts had been still left open and unshielded. The bow shields for these mounts have been noteworthy for getting a bulge to the remaining side to be able to accommodate the Mechanical Fuze Setter.
Notice the Fuze environment mechanism to the remaining facet of the mount, a common aspect on all pedestal mounts and those foundation ring mounts lacking hoists. Sketch from OP-1112. impression courtesy of HNSA.

As is usually viewed in these pics, the Mechanical Fuze Setter had 3 projectile slots. The ammunition passers positioned Just about every projectile nose-down into among the list of slots, fitting the mounted lug over the fuze (see illustration below) in the V-groove in the slot. Each and every slot had a rotating cup with a pawl that engaged some time ring lug within the projectile. Moving this ring set the fuze time. Once the projectile was in position, the ammunition passer turned the crank Positioned underneath the cup which rotated the cup and therefore the fuze time ring into the Preliminary placing. Afterwards, the Mechanical Fuze Setter would constantly read more rotate the nose cups to match the most recent time environment as determined by the pc (automated manner) or via the Fuze Setter Crewman (Manual method). possessing three slots authorized enough time for each successive projectile being set to the appropriate time placing prior to the shell man (very first loader) picked it out on the equipment and positioned it into the gun loading tray. this process of fuze location also permitted some time fuzes to be continually current by the computer until The instant they were plucked from your device, Hence making certain the absolute best setting for each person shell and minimizing the "deadtime" interval involving each time a shell was plucked from your Mechanical Fuze Setter and when it absolutely was fired out with the gun. The first loader stepped with a foot pedal to lift the shell out in the nose cup system as he pulled the shell out in the Fuze Setter. When firing VT Fuzed (Proximity) AA projectiles, there was no really need to set the time as the VT fuze alone decided once the projectile should detonate. The put up-war managed Variable Time (CVT) Fuze did use a time environment which delayed enabling the fuze till several seconds in advance of it attained the goal. This diminished the probabilities that rain or sea return would induce a untimely detonation.
^Ramming was energy-labored on all mountings and was either pneumatic or by a 5 hp electrical motor with hydraulic drive. This permitted any-angle loading and therefore a sustained large amount of fireplace even at large elevations. In an emergency, guns could possibly be manually rammed but This might not be performed once the gun was at significant elevations because the projectiles would slide back out.

during the photograph of USS Shaw (DD-373) at ideal, the officer is pointing towards the a few circular dials that sort the Sight Setting Dial Cluster. The enlisted male with the head phones standing next to him could be the "Sight Setter" who operated the Sight placing dials. These dials have been "Keep to the pointer" indicators which showed the deflection angle (bearing) in the LH glass facial area dial as well as the sight angle (superelevation) in the RH glass facial area dial whilst the selection was proven by the bottom steel facial area dial. Inside Just about every of the two glass-face dials were being two smaller dials - an inner disc dial mounted on the synchro motor shaft and an outer ring dial inscribed by using a scale. The internal disc dial synchro motors ended up operated from your fire Handle Personal computer and confirmed the desired sight angle and deflection angle as calculated by the computer. The outer ring dials, managed from the Sight Setter by way of two hand cranks, confirmed the current sight angle and deflection angle from the gunsights. The underside dial was the assortment indicator While using the black slot on the right becoming the readout place, showing the variety in yards. The range dial as well as the sight angle dial were geared together to operate in the exact hand crank.
